Hallelujah Effect : Philosophical Reflections On Music, Performance Practice and Technology.
Babich, Babette.(Ashgate Popular And Folk Music Series)
Ashgate ©2013
This book studies Leonard Cohen's song Hallelujah in the context of today's culture, focusing in particular on k. d. lang's YouTube rendition of the music. With a bibliography and index. Illustrations.
